16. Boromir
When I first watched the Fellowship of the Ring, I hated Boromir. He was a jealous $!$% who felt threatened by Aragorn. And he wanted to take the ring and use it for his own selfish, power hungry reasons. I was glad when he died. But upon a second watching, I liked him more. He seems like one of those tough guys (see Sawyer from Lost) who is tough for a reason - because his past was fucked up and he went through hard times. He has good intentions at heart. And he died protecting the hobbits from orcs, which is admirable. His family sucks, but he's all right. 15. Bilbo Baggins
Bilbo's a good character but he's kind of pathetic. He was under the Ring's power for a long, long time and became addicted to it, almost like a drug. Even though he knew it was best for him, he still had a hard time leaving the Ring behind when he left the Shire. When he was an old ass man and on his deathbed, he still wanted the Ring. Dude, get over it. Overall Bilbo just seemed like a really selfish character who only cared about himself and the Ring. I do like his adventurous spirit however. Hopefully they make a The Hobbit movie someday so we can find out more about his past and how he came about finding the Ring. 14. Theoden
When we first met Theoden, he was just a miserable shell under the power of Saruman. After being freed by Gandalf is when we got to meet the real Theoden. He's actually a good guy who has a strong sense of justice and doing the right thing. He was apprehensive about helping Gondor, since they did not help Rohan in their time of need. But in the end he did the right thing, which really shows his true character. Theoden seemed like a good, compassionate man who genuinely cared about family and the well being of others. Can't fault that, can you? He only doesn't rank higher because he wasn't very colorful and was too business like all the time. |
